    Mal, a purple-haired teenager with an indomitable spirit, lived in a small village nestled at the foot of the Dragon Mountains. The villagers always felt safe because of a prophecy about a Dragon Warrior.

    One day, while exploring the mountains, Mal stumbled upon an ancient cave. Inside, she found a shimmering sword and a glowing necklace. They were the legendary Dragonblade and Dragon Heart.

    As Mal touched them, she felt an immense power surge through her. The prophecy was true; she was the destined Dragon Warrior. She knew she had a mission to fulfill.

    The next day, Mal began her training. She learned to wield the Dragonblade with grace and precision, and the Dragon Heart amplified her magical abilities.

    One day, she discovered that when she got angry, she could transform into a giant purple dragon. This new power both scared and excited her.

    Mal's transformation did not go unnoticed. A dark sorcerer named Gravos sensed her power and sought to control it. He plotted to capture Mal.

    Meanwhile, Mal continued her training, unaware of Gravos's plans. She also started making friends with the dragons in the mountains, honing her communication skills.

    One day, Gravos attacked Mal's village. The villagers were terrified, but Mal was ready. She confronted Gravos, her Dragonblade gleaming in the sun.

    A battle ensued. Gravos was a formidable opponent, but Mal was not deterred. She fought valiantly, using her sword and her magic.

    Things took a turn when Gravos managed to snatch the Dragon Heart from Mal. He used its power to enhance his own, pushing Mal to her limits.

    But Mal was not defeated. She remembered her dragon friends. With a loud roar, she called them. Within seconds, dragons from the mountains swooped down.

    The dragons attacked Gravos, distracting him long enough for Mal to snatch back the Dragon Heart. Its power returned to her, and she felt stronger than ever.

    The final clash between Mal and Gravos was fierce. Mal, now in her dragon form, unleashed a burst of magical fire from the Dragonblade, defeating Gravos.

    The villagers cheered as Gravos was banished. Mal was hailed as their savior. Her courage and determination had saved them all from the dark sorcerer's wrath.

    With Gravos gone, peace returned to the village. Mal continued to train, knowing that as the Dragon Warrior, she had the responsibility to protect her people.

    Mal's adventures were far from over. But she was ready to face whatever came her way, with the Dragonblade by her side and the Dragon Heart around her neck.

    She became a symbol of hope for her people. Her story, the story of the Dragon Warrior, was told and retold, inspiring generations to come.

    Through it all, Mal remained humble. She never forgot her roots, and always helped those in need. She was not just a warrior, but a hero.

    As years passed, Mal grew older. But her spirit remained as fiery as ever. Her legacy, the Dragonblade Chronicles, continued to inspire many.

    The Dragonblade and Dragon Heart were passed down to the next Dragon Warrior, a young boy named Kai. He looked up to Mal as his mentor and guide.

    Mal taught Kai everything she knew. She trained him to wield the Dragonblade and use the Dragon Heart's magic. She saw herself in him.

    Kai was a quick learner. He soon mastered the art of transformation, turning into a powerful green dragon. Mal was proud of him.

    Together, Mal and Kai defended their village from various threats. Their bond grew stronger, and they became a formidable team, always ready to protect their home.

    The Dragonblade Chronicles lived on through Kai. The story of Mal, the purple-haired Dragon Warrior, was now a legend, inspiring all who heard it.

    Mal and Kai's adventures continued. They faced new challenges, but their courage and determination never wavered. They were the true Dragon Warriors.

    And so, the story of the Dragonblade Chronicles continued. With each new adventure, the legend of Mal and Kai grew, inspiring future generations of Dragon Warriors.
